Hi all, does anyone out there know what changes gears are required on a Harrison L5 to cut a 6tpi thread. I have no gear chart on the lathe to guide me   :scratch:  hence the plea.

I'm not familiar with the lathe but, assuming it has an Imperial leadscrew, it should be easy to puzzle out the required ratio.

Say the leadscrew has a pitch of N tpi.  One revolution of the LS will move the carriage 1/N inches.  To cut a 6 tpi thread, you need to have it move 1/6 of an inch for each revolution of the spindle.

Thus the spindle to leadscrew ratio needs to be N/6.  Any set of gears that yields this ratio should do the trick.
